According to https://github.com/Pylons/waitress/blob/master/CONTRIBUTORS.txt#L91 the license for the docs/ directory and the docstrings is Creative Commons Attribution-Noncommercial-Share Alike 3.0 United States License. This is a problem for distributions like openSUSE or Debian. The problem was already discussed (see https://groups.google.com/forum/#!searchin/pylons-devel/commercial/pylons-devel/M__sXP0W-Ws/Yee63QK0aGcJ ) but without any conclusion. So what do people think about changing the license for docs/ and docstrings so the distributions can ship it?
